AGRA: The Archeological Survey of India ( ASI ) has decided to put ‘temporary’ kiosks for buying cashless entry tickets (through credit card/money transfer) to Taj Mahal , especially on weekends, following a complaint from a foreign tourist that he had to spend an hour and half in a line to purchase a ticket.The decision was taken at a meeting chaired by ASI director general Usha Sharma in Delhi on Monday.According to officials, the aim of adding the temporary kiosks is to make buying tickets simpler and speedier..
